Video: Truy vấn tham gia là gì?
2024 Tác giả: Lynn Donovan | [email protected]. Sửa đổi lần cuối: 2023-12-15 23:55
SQL tham gia mệnh đề - tương ứng với một tham gia hoạt động trong đại số quan hệ - kết hợp các cột từ một hoặc nhiều bảng trong cơ sở dữ liệu quan hệ. Nó tạo ra một tập hợp có thể được lưu dưới dạng bảng hoặc được sử dụng như nó vốn có. MỘT THAM GIA là một phương tiện để kết hợp các cột từ một (tự tham gia ) hoặc nhiều bảng bằng cách sử dụng các giá trị chung cho mỗi bảng.
Cũng được hỏi, tham gia với ví dụ là gì?
Một SQL Tham gia câu lệnh được sử dụng để kết hợp tổ chức dữ liệu từ hai hoặc nhiều bảng dựa trên một trường chung giữa chúng. Tham gia là: INNER THAM GIA . BÊN TRÁI THAM GIA . ĐÚNG THAM GIA.
Tương tự, các phép nối trong SQL hoạt động như thế nào? Các loại SQL JOINs khác nhau
- (INNER) JOIN: Trả về các bản ghi có giá trị phù hợp trong cả hai bảng.
- LEFT (OUTER) JOIN: Trả về tất cả các bản ghi từ bảng bên trái và các bản ghi phù hợp từ bảng bên phải.
- RIGHT (OUTER) JOIN: Trả về tất cả các bản ghi từ bảng bên phải và các bản ghi đã so khớp từ bảng bên trái.
Xem xét điều này, các loại nối là gì và giải thích mỗi loại?
Có bốn cơ bản các loại của SQL tham gia : bên trong, bên trái, bên phải và đầy đủ. Cách dễ nhất và trực quan nhất để giải thích sự khác biệt giữa bốn cái này các loại đang sử dụng biểu đồ Venn, biểu đồ này hiển thị tất cả các quan hệ logic có thể có giữa các tập dữ liệu.
Tại sao chúng ta sử dụng phép nối trong SQL?
Các SQL tham gia mệnh đề Được sử dụng để kết hợp các từ vựng từ hai hoặc nhiều bảng trong cơ sở dữ liệu. MỘT THAM GIA là người Mỹ để kết hợp các trường từ hai bảng bằng cách sử dụng giá trị chung cho mỗi. BÊN TRÁI THAM GIA - trả về tất cả các hàng từ bảng bên trái, ngay cả khi ở đó là không có kết quả phù hợp nào trong bảng bên phải.
Đề xuất:
Tôi có thể sử dụng tham gia truy vấn cập nhật không?
Để truy vấn dữ liệu từ các bảng có liên quan, bạn thường sử dụng các mệnh đề nối, hoặc phép nối bên trong hoặc phép nối bên trái. Trong SQL Server, bạn có thể sử dụng các mệnh đề nối này trong câu lệnh CẬP NHẬT để thực hiện cập nhật bảng chéo. Đầu tiên, chỉ định tên của bảng (t1) mà bạn muốn cập nhật trong mệnh đề CẬP NHẬT
Tham gia bên ngoài có giống với tham gia bên ngoài đầy đủ không?
Trong phép nối bên ngoài, tất cả dữ liệu liên quan từ cả hai bảng được kết hợp chính xác, cộng với tất cả các hàng còn lại từ một bảng. Trong kết nối bên ngoài đầy đủ, tất cả dữ liệu được kết hợp bất cứ khi nào có thể
Số lượng bảng tối đa có thể tham gia một truy vấn là bao nhiêu?
Số lượng bảng tối đa có thể được tham chiếu trong một phép nối là 61. Điều này cũng áp dụng cho số lượng bảng có thể được tham chiếu trong định nghĩa của một dạng xem
Sự khác biệt giữa tham số giá trị và tham chiếu là gì?
Người gọi không nhìn thấy các thay đổi đối với tham số giá trị (còn được gọi là 'chuyển theo giá trị'). Người gọi có thể nhìn thấy các thay đổi đối với tham số tham chiếu ('chuyển theo tham chiếu'). Một cách sử dụng con trỏ là triển khai các tham số 'tham chiếu' mà không sử dụng khái niệm tham chiếu đặc biệt, mà một số ngôn ngữ, chẳng hạn như C, không có
Toán tử so sánh nào được sử dụng để so sánh giá trị với mọi giá trị được trả về bởi truy vấn con?
Toán tử ALL được sử dụng để chọn tất cả các bộ giá trị của SELECT STATEMENT. Nó cũng được sử dụng để so sánh một giá trị với mọi giá trị trong một tập giá trị khác hoặc kết quả từ một truy vấn con. Toán tử ALL trả về TRUE iff tất cả các giá trị truy vấn con đáp ứng điều kiện